#301ddf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#301ddf is composed of 18.8% red, 11.4%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.5% cyan, 87%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 245.9 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 49.4%. #301ddf color hex could be obtained by blending #603aff with #0000bf.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#301ddf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020f is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#301ddf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7e7e is the less saturated color, while #200af2 is the most saturated one.
